Company overview

William Blair is a global investment banking and asset management firm headquartered in Chicago. The company provides advisory services, investment solutions, and market insights to individuals, institutions, and corporations. Founded in 1935, it has a rich history of fostering long-term relationships and delivering innovative financial strategies. William Blair makes money through investment banking fees, asset management services, and advisory commissions. The firm is known for its client-centric approach and commitment to integrity, excellence, and teamwork.
